Conjugation ready
Our carrier-free antibodies are typically supplied in a PBS-only formulation, purified and free of BSA, sodium azide and glycerol. This conjugation-ready format is designed for use with fluorochromes, metal isotopes, oligonucleotides, and enzymes, which makes them ideal for antibody labelling, functional and cell-based assays, flow-based assays (e.g. mass cytometry) and Multiplex Imaging applications.

Biological function summary
Tropomodulin 3 interacts with components of the cytoskeleton to help maintain cell shape and stability. It often functions as part of a multi-protein complex with tropomyosin which stabilizes the actin filament and protects it from depolymerization. Through its interaction with actin and tropomyosin TMOD3 influences cell motility division and muscle contraction essential processes in cellular and tissue dynamics.
Pathways
Tropomodulin 3 plays a part in the actin cytoskeleton regulation pathway. It regulates the turnover and length of actin filaments which connect to processes like cell adhesion and movement. The regulation of actin filament dynamics by TMOD3 influences interactions with associated proteins such as myosin which drives cellular movements and mechanical support.
